| Sound Type | Free Source | How to process it for Hardtekk |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| 909 Kick (Samples from the 90s) | Add "Decapitator" or "CamelCrusher" distortion. Boost 100Hz. | | Snare/Clap | Roland 909 Clap | Pitch up +15 semitones. Add heavy reverb (Room size: large). | | Riff/Lead | "Hoover Factory" VST (Free) | Play a minor 7th chord. Resample it. Add a low-pass filter sweep. | | Breakbeat | "Amen Brother" WAV (Public Domain-ish) | Chop at 1/16th notes. Pitch up to 170 BPM. Add bit-crushing. | | Atmosphere | Field Recording (Record your radiator) | Stretch it to 200% length. Reverse it. Add band-pass filter. |

Hardtekk is a subgenre of Techno that originated in Germany in the 1990s. Characterized by its fast-paced and energetic sound, Hardtekk often features distorted basslines, piercing leads, and driving drum patterns. The genre has gained popularity worldwide, with many producers incorporating Hardtekk elements into their music.
